Byron Shire Council is holding two citizenship ceremonies on Australia Day with more than 60 people wanting to become Australian citizens on 26 January 2020.

Director Corporate and Community Services, Vanessa Adams, said the response from people wanting to become Australian citizens has been extraordinary.

“We normally have large numbers of people coming to Byron Shire Council wanting to become citizens and this year we are holding two ceremonies because we can only cater for 30 people at a time in our Council Chambers,” Ms Adams said.

“They are joyous and emotional occasions filled with family and friends and we even have people on a waiting list this year,” she said.

The citizenship ceremonies will be held at the Mullumbimby Council Chambers on 26 January starting at 9:00am and 11:30am.

 

 

Australia Day in Byron Shire

Sports commentator and passionate advocate for heart health, Mr Andy Paschalidis, is the Byron Shire’s 2020 Australia Day Ambassador.

Mr Paschalidis will join Mayor Simon Richardson and invited guests on 25 January for the announcement of the Byron Shire 2020 Australia Day Award winners and then attend a number of community events on 26 January.

Mr Paschalidis is a sports commentator but it is for his work establishing the not-for-profit organisation, Heartbeat of Football, that he is really kicking goals.

He founded Heartbeat of Football (HoF) in 2016 after more than 10 amateur football players died in Australia in two years from heart-related incidents.

Since then HoF has partnered with Football NSW to create greater awareness of heart disease in the code, advocating for defibrillators to be located at all sporting grounds and conducting free testing, education and awareness sessions for players as well as coaches and spectators.
